The short-term rental market in Lansing, Michigan remains active in 2026, supported by ongoing visitor demand. The average daily rate is approximately $95. These figures reflect 2024 baseline data adjusted for 2025–2026 ADR growth of 3–5% and the modest occupancy compression seen across the U.S. short-term rental sector as new supply has entered the market.
For investors and operators evaluating Lansing, the broader Michigan dynamic remains favorable: rate strength continues to offset volume softness, keeping RevPAR (revenue per available rental) relatively stable year-over-year. Hyperlocal factors — neighborhood-level demand, seasonality, and the regulatory environment — should be confirmed before making investment or pricing decisions.

To ensure the success of a short term rental business in Lansing, Michigan, several practical tips can be implemented to enhance guest satisfaction and compliance with local regulations.
Inform guests about quiet hours through clear communication in your listing and in a digital or physical house manual. This helps maintain a respectful environment for both guests and neighbors, adhering to Lansing's noise regulations.
Create a detailed digital and physical house manual that includes essential instructions, such as Wi-Fi passwords, appliance usage, and safety information. This manual should also outline house rules, emergency contact details, and local attractions to make the guest's stay more comfortable and informed.
Utilize smart locks to streamline the check-in process, eliminating the need for physical key exchanges. Provide guests with clear instructions on how to access the property, along with photos of the entrance and any specific steps they need to follow. This ensures a smooth and hassle-free arrival experience.
Include detailed parking instructions in your house manual, accompanied by photos to help guests identify designated parking areas. This reduces confusion and potential issues with neighbors, making the overall stay more enjoyable.
By implementing these strategies, you can enhance the guest experience, reduce potential conflicts, and ensure your short term rental business in Lansing, Michigan, operates efficiently and successfully.
Short-term rental management fees in Lansing, Michigan in 2026 typically range from 15% to 30% of gross rental revenue, depending on the scope of services provided. Full-service management — covering guest communication, channel distribution across Airbnb, Vrbo, and Booking.com, dynamic pricing, cleaning coordination, and 24/7 guest support — generally falls in the 22% to 30% range. Co-hosting or partial-service arrangements that leave more responsibility with the owner usually run 15% to 20%.
Industry-wide management fees have crept upward by roughly 1–2 percentage points since 2024 as operating costs, insurance premiums, and labor expenses have risen across the vacation rental sector. Lansing-area managers may also charge separately for cleaning turnovers, maintenance dispatch, linen programs, and listing optimization. Some full-service operators in Michigan now offer guaranteed-rent or revenue-share hybrid models, which can be worth comparing against a flat percentage structure for higher-revenue properties.
